Reading The S.A.E. Micrometer (.0001" Version)







A. Note the whole inch if appropriate. Write it down.
Example: 3.

B. Read the sleeve to the tenth and record.
Example: 3. + .2 = 3.2

C. Read the sleeve to the 25 thousandths (.025) and record.
Example: 3.2 + .05 = 3.25

D. Read the thimble to the thousandth (.001) and record.
Example: 3.25 + .007 = 3.257

E. Read the thimble to the half-thousandth (.0005) and record.
Example: 3.257 + .0005 = 3.2575

F. Finally, read the sleeve vernier to the closest tenth-thousandth (.00001) and ADD to the half-thousandth reading.
Example: 3.2527 + .0003 = 3.2578

Review Of Example

Whole Inch: 3.0 inch
Tenths: .2 inch
25 Thousandths: .05 inch
1 Thousandths: .007 inch
Half-thousandths: .0005 inch
Ten-thousandths: .0003 inch

Total: 3.2578 inch
